Problem

Existing image printing apparatuses do not effectively manage consumable ink usage based on predetermined use conditions, leading to potential misuse or inefficiency in ink refilling operations.

Innovation Solution

An image printing apparatus with a mounting unit for ink tanks, a print head, a sub tank for ink supply, and a control unit that prevents or allows ink refilling based on compliance with predetermined conditions, ensuring appropriate processing and usage.

Data Source

PatentUS12145369B2Image printing apparatus, control method of image printing apparatus and processing apparatus
Publication Date: 2024.11.19 CANON KK

AI summary

For appropriate execution of processing depending on a condition in an image printing apparatus, the image printing apparatus includes a mounting unit on which a tank is mountable, a print head, a sub tank which receives ink from the tank and supplies the ink to the print head, and a refilling unit which refills the sub tank with ink from the tank. In a case where a tank mounted on the mounting unit is noncompliant with a predetermined condition, the control unit prevents the refilling unit from refilling the sub tank with ink from the tank. In contrast, in a case where a tank mounted on the mounting unit is compliant with the predetermined condition, the control unit causes the refilling unit to refill the sub tank with ink from the tank.
